    Spectacular days await as you cruise Disko Bay. Ilulissat is the main town on the bay, named from the Inuit word for 'iceberg'. It's famous for the large number of icebergs breaking away from the nearby Ilulissat Icefjord, a UNESCO World Heritage-listed site. The Icefjord is the mouth of the vast Sermeq Kujalleq glacier, one of the world's fastest moving and most active glaciers, calving a remarkable 46 cubic kilometers of ice annually. Listen for the rumbling sounds in the distance as huge chunks of ice break from the glacier and tumble into the water below.     Sitting around 40 kilometers north of the Arctic Circle, Sisimiut is the second-largest town in Greenland. With colorful houses sprinkled around a picturesque bay, the town is bathed in perpetual sunlight during the summer months. Explore Sisimiut's rich history, dating back some 4,500 years, at the local museum, which has a collection of ancient Saqqaq artifacts. You'll have the opportunity to purchase souvenirs crafted from qiviut, the inner wool of a muskox, such as scarves, hats, or mittens.     Sitting at the northern tip of the island of Newfoundland, L'Anse aux Meadows is the site of the first recorded European contact with North America. It's a true milestone in the history of human migration and discovery. Now a UNESCO World Heritage Site, it marks the sole Viking-established settlement on the continent, dating back to the 11th century. The archaeological remnants, including remnants of wood-framed peat-turf buildings, mirror those found in Norse Greenland Iceland. Exploring the site, you'll embark on a fascinating journey tracing the footsteps of Vikings who arrived in North America centuries before Columbus.     Scenic Eclipse will continue sailing down the west coast of Newfoundland, bound for Bonne Bay and Woody Point. These small towns are nestled within Gros Morne National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age-listed site that was formed over 485 million years. This sprawling and beautiful park is made up of strikingly diverse landscapes, from moody mountains and deep fjords to barren tablelands and deserted beaches. On the water, the cove is divided into Inner and Outer Bonne Bay. Inner Bonne Bay boasts serene wooded coves and sandy beaches, while Outer Bonne Bay serves as the gateway to the majestic Bonne Bay fjord.     Step into a piece of living history when you go ashore at Louisbourg on Cape Breton Island. This well-preserved 18th-century fortress will immerse you in French colonial life amidst charming cobblestone streets and historic buildings. It's the largest historical reconstruction in North America and authentic fortifications, kitchen gardens, and homes sit alongside the original ruins. Uncover the secrets of this UNESCO World Heritage-listed site as you wander through its picturesque streets and soak in the unique atmosphere.     Halifax, Nova Scotia's dynamic capital, has long been tied to the sea. It has one of the largest and deepest ice-free harbors in the world, and has been an important military and commercial port for more than 250 years. Today, you can learn about its rich cultural heritage through the city's many museums and historical sites.     Lunenburg is one of Canada's most beautiful towns, a UNESCO World Heritage-listed site where 70 percent of the original buildings from the 18th and 19th centuries still stand. It is the best surviving example of a British colonial settlement in North America, set out along an orderly grid pattern. You'll be charmed by its picturesque colorful houses and architectural wonders like the Lunenburg Academy, the pink Wedding Cake House, and St. John's Anglican Church. The historic waterfront is now home to a lively mix of restaurants, breweries, distilleries, and boutiques, all of which embrace the town's proud seafaring legacy.
